BBC News – Exorcism chapel opened in Mexico
A Mexican church in the central city of Queretaro has opened a chapel in which exorcisms can take place.
There are no accurate figures for the number of exorcisms in Mexico.
But the Roman Catholic Church says that in Mexico City alone there are about 10 cases a month – and the phenomenon is on the rise.
Critics say that priests often mistake mental illness or epilepsy for signs of possession. The new church will only treat people already seen by doctors.
